PENGWIN Task 1: Pelvic Fracture Segmentation on CT

Description

The CT segmentation task (Task 1) of the PENGWIN segmentation challenge is designed to advance the development of automated fracture segmentation methods for pelvic CT scans, with a focus on enhancing their accuracy and efficiency. Our dataset comprises CT scans from 150 patients scheduled for pelvic reduction surgery, collected from multiple institutions using a variety of scanning equipment. This dataset represents a diverse range of patient cohorts and fracture types. Ground-truth segmentations for sacrum and hipbone fragments have been semi-automatically annotated and subsequently validated by medical experts. 

This repository contains the training set of 100 CT scans with pelvic fractures and their ground-truth segmentation labels. The images and labels are stored in mha format. Each bone anatomy (sacrum, left hipbone, right hipbone) has up to 10 fragments. Bone that does not present any fracuture has only one fragment, which is itself. Label assignment: 0 = background, 1-10 = sacrum fragment, 11-20 = left hipbone fragment, 21-30 = right hipbone fragment.
